If I gave you that impression, my appologies. I think the Onkyo and the HTDs go very well together.
In terms of receivers, I didn't find anything in the sub $300 range that was as good as the Onkyo. I listened to some Sony, Panasonic, and Pioneer receivers in that price range, and found they just sounded more distorted even at lower volumes.
As far as the sub goes, I didn't hear anyhing for less than $300 at retail that didn't either lack power or sound boomy. I don't know anything about DIY, so I can't really recommend a better sub at that price either.
While I have not found the Level 2 sub to be either incredibly tight nor incredibly powerful, it doesn't sound boomy either, and provides sufficient output for the rooms I use it in. I'd imagine the Level 3 is not any worse in those regards.
However, keep in mind that the last time I was really comparing stuff in this price range was a couple of years ago, so it is possible things have changed since then.
